13 Reasons No One Visits Your Website

Lack of optimization, good content, and efforts to promote are some reasons why no one is visiting your website. Confusing messages and slow loading web pages can also drive your visitors away. 

A website is essential for attracting your customers from all around the world. You need a trustworthy website in today’s world when technology is continuously growing, and businesses are shifting to the internet. If you want a fantastic result, let’s talk about the causes behind your website’s lack of reach and audience.

13 Reasons No One Visits Your Website

The major challenge in today’s competitive marketplace is securing and maintaining the search engine traffic that will catapult your website to the top. Unfortunately, there’s a good chance that conversions will suffer if there isn’t a clear and strategic plan to enhance website traffic.

Putting up texts, images, CTA buttons, and designing the website is not enough. Your website isn’t getting traffic for a multitude of reasons. So, we’ve listed 13 possible reasons why no one is visiting your website. 

Reason #1: No one visits your website because it isn’t SEO optimized.

As a business owner, you should be aware of the importance of SEO. Websites that aren’t SEO-friendly don’t appear in Google’s top three search results. Thus, you have a lower chance of getting clicks.

When a website’s exposure is low, a large portion of the audience is ignorant of it, particularly the one you want to target. Fortunately, there are a few different techniques to improve your website for SEO.

  • Use relevant keywords in your text, headings, tags, and title. However, don’t overdo it.
  • Integrating unique and relevant content into your web pages.
  • Take advantage of internal links.

Reason #2: You’re using too many keywords.

Make sure you do good SEO of your website but don’t overdo it. Your chances of appearing in the search results are slim if you’ve gone above with your keywords. Think about it, is it one of the reasons no one visits your website?

Unlike in the early days of the internet, search engine algorithms can detect keyword overuse and penalize your site accordingly. Even if you can rank an average website on Google, visitors will abandon your pages as quickly as they arrive.

Reason #3: No one visits your website because you have a horrible backlink profile or no profile at all.

Backlinks are crucial to your search engine rankings. The majority of pages in the top three or so have high-quality links bringing browsers to them. Their domain has a lot of authority. It means their link profile contains dozens and dozens of backlinks from the top in their sector.

You probably don’t have many backlinks if you haven’t tried link building before. If that’s the case, it’s most likely the main reason you’re not generating any Google traffic.

Reason #4: Your website is new.

If your website is brand new, it will not receive sufficient online traffic. The explanation for this is simple. It’s because Google has yet to find your website. Google and other search engines send a web crawler to your website. Then, it examines and indexes the information. 

Your website will be visible to users worldwide after indexing it. But, all of these indexing and crawling take time. Web design experts have ways to speed things up by making sitemap and submitting it through Google Search Console. Thus, it’s better to consult and ask a professional web design company in San Jose to do it for you.

Reason #5: You don’t give enough social media presence.

To get people to visit your website, you must first make them aware of it. It’s only possible if you have a solid social media presence. Create an account and use social media for advertising your websites, such as Facebook, Instagram, and Twitter. 

To properly communicate with your audience, constantly publish your website on these sites. It sounds easy, but make sure only to share quality shareable content.

Reason #6: The website loads slowly.

If you have a website that takes too long to load its content, then you’re in big trouble. Remember that websites that load in less than two seconds are deemed quick and attract more visitors. On the other hand, websites that load faster in Google’s search and display results rank higher.

Visitors will not like your website if it has slow-loading web pages that take longer than three seconds to load. No one wants that. Slow-loading websites degrade the user experience, which is the last thing you want. 

Reason #7: Your website does not have a professional touch.

Nothing is wrong with DIY your website, but it could be one of the reasons no one visits your website. Fortunately, there are things that only a professional web designer can do for you. Your website should be aesthetically pleasant and professional in appearance to attract a broad audience. 

Contact us if you want a professional web design for your website. Professional web designers in the Bay Area can assist you in attracting more visitors to your website.

Reason #8: Your website is not responsive.

More than 70% of web searches or users use their mobile devices. So it means one thing: your website should cater to these audiences. If you don’t have a responsive website, you’ll lose most of your potential leads. Furthermore, responsive websites assist you in achieving higher conversion rates.

Reason #9: Your website exhibits poor content.

If your website’s content is poor, people are less inclined to visit it. This type of content may be irrelevant, of little value, or challenging to read or comprehend. If you don’t provide new content regularly, you’ll most certainly lose visitors.

A website’s content continues to be supreme even in this modern era. After all, it’s why visitors come to your website to see what you’ve posted. Simply posting a few paragraphs about your company or group will not suffice. At the very least, in terms of attracting high-quality traffic and enticing buyers to engage. Make time to review your material frequently after researching how to improve it.

Reason #10: You don’t post high-quality blogs consistently.

If you want to see excellent results for your business, you must start blogging if you are not currently doing it regularly. Depending on your schedule, it’s preferable to start posting twice a month and gradually reduce it to once or twice a week. 

The content should not be solely about your company. Make it as informative as possible to regularly visit the website. You can discuss the business’s exclusivity, the things that these businesses sell, the company’s stellar reputation, and the personnel.

Pick up on various topics that are essential to both the industry and the audience. Include different visual components such as photographs, videos, and other media in blog postings. Increase your focus on what Google regards as high-quality material and do everything you can to curate it. The traffic will be better if the material is of more excellent quality.

If you don’t have time to write and publish blogs on your website, Salazar Digital can help you with that, too. 

Reason #11: Your website has a confusing or disengaging home page.

No one wants to continue browsing a website once they see a very confusing and disengaging home page. Some people might even think that it is a scam website. Thus, it’s probably who no one visits your website.

Visitors that come to your website will leave if your main page is too confusing. So it’s always better to keep things simple. A good website never wastes the time of its visitors. Instead, it appears to be a valuable resource for the target audience.

Reason #12: You use headlines that are not click-worthy.

You’re unlikely to receive many clicks if your headlines aren’t compelling. Regardless of how high you rank in search engines or how frequently you appear in social media news feeds. Because headlines are the first thing internet customers see before deciding whether or not to visit your site, they are crucial. No one will click your website or a blog if your audience thinks it’s not worthy of their time.

Reason #13: You spend too much time creating but not promoting.

We all know that high-quality material is essential to the success of our blogs. So there’s a strong probability that if you write a blog article every week, you’ll get a steady stream of organic traffic. 

Have you ever heard the phrase “publish and pray”? In simple terms, it refers to a blogger with little to no authority who posts blog post after blog post without any marketing in the hopes of attracting traffic from unexpected sources.

It’s as if you push the publish button and hope someone reads it, even if you have no idea how that person will find your blog post. But the truth is that no one will see your content in a search engine or newsfeed if you don’t have any brand/website authority. So that is why you must advertise your work actively.


Those 13 reasons no one visits your website are just a reminder of why no one is visiting your website. For every reason that we provided, it requires a different approach to fixing the problem. It’s not easy to do it all, especially if you’re handling your business’s internal and external operations.

That’s why we are here for you. You can always contact us if you need professional web design services in San Jose, CA, and nearby areas.


Salazar Digital

1172 Murphy Ave suite #208, San Jose, CA 95131, United States


Looking For Something?

The Salazar Digital Blog

Our goal is to inform an audience of business owners looking to benefit from information about the web, and how it can help them grow their brand.

Recent Posts

Committed to Your Success

Use the form below to contact us. We look forward to learning more about you, your organization, and how we can help you achieve even greater success.